Juniper (Juniperus communis) is a hardy evergreen conifer shrub and one of only three conifers native to the UK, valued for gardens, moorland planting and wildlife schemes. Growing well in any well drained soil, Juniper thrives on chalk, moorland and rocky sites, and can reach up to around 8 metres in height, though it more often develops as a low, spreading shrub. Its aromatic, needle-like foliage provides dense year round cover, while blue black berries, best known for flavouring gin, offer a valuable food source for birds and insects through the colder months. Slow growing and long lived, Juniper can live for hundreds of years once established.

As one of Britain's few native conifers, Juniper holds particular value for wildlife and conservation planting, forming a dense, textured shrub well suited to coastal or exposed sites.

Juniper is dioecious, meaning individual plants are either male or female, with only female plants producing the berries prized for their culinary and wildlife value.
